Title:
STEEL FOR MACHINE STRUCTURAL USE

Abstract:

PROBLEM TO BE SOLVED: To provide inexpensive steel for machine structural use which does not substantially comprise Pb and has excellent machinability, and in which the anisotropy of mechanical properties is reduced.
SOLUTION: The steel for machine structural use has a chemical composition comprising 0.1 to 0.6% C, 0.03 to 2.0% Si, 0.2 to 2.0% Mn, 0.03 to 0.20% S, ≤0.1% P, 0.001 to 0.02% N, 0.0003 to 0.005% Al, 0.0001 to 0.01% Ca, 0.0005 to 0.005% O, and 0.0001 to 0.01% Te, and the balance Fe with impurities, and in which the content of Mg in the impurities is controlled to ≤0.001%, and comprises MnS-based inclusions including 0.1 to 0.6 atomic% Te and having a shape in which the width W is ≥2μm, and also, the ratio between the length L and the width W, L/W is ≤5 in the longitudinally vertical section. The steel can further comprise one or more kinds of metals selected from Ti, Cr, V, Mo, Nb, Cu, and Ni or/and one or more kinds of metals selected from Bi and REMs (rare earth metals).
